Christopher Ferris30659fd2019-04-15 19:01:08 -070033// Structures for android_mallopt.
34
35typedef struct {
36 // Pointer to the buffer allocated by a call to M_GET_MALLOC_LEAK_INFO.
37 uint8_t* buffer;
38 // The size of the "info" buffer.
39 size_t overall_size;
40 // The size of a single entry.
41 size_t info_size;
42 // The sum of all allocations that have been tracked. Does not include
43 // any heap overhead.
44 size_t total_memory;
45 // The maximum number of backtrace entries.
46 size_t backtrace_size;
47} android_mallopt_leak_info_t;

Ryan Savitskiecc37e32018-12-14 15:57:21 +000049// Opcodes for android_mallopt.
50
Ryan Savitskif77928d2019-01-23 18:39:35 +000051enum {
Florian Mayerdb59b892018-11-27 17:06:54 +000052 // Marks the calling process as a profileable zygote child, possibly
53 // initializing profiling infrastructure.
Ryan Savitskif77928d2019-01-23 18:39:35 +000054 M_INIT_ZYGOTE_CHILD_PROFILING = 1,
55#define M_INIT_ZYGOTE_CHILD_PROFILING M_INIT_ZYGOTE_CHILD_PROFILING
Florian Mayerdb59b892018-11-27 17:06:54 +000056 M_RESET_HOOKS = 2,
57#define M_RESET_HOOKS M_RESET_HOOKS
Christopher Ferris1fc5ccf2019-02-15 18:06:15 -080058 // Set an upper bound on the total size in bytes of all allocations made
59 // using the memory allocation APIs.
60 // arg = size_t*
61 // arg_size = sizeof(size_t)
62 M_SET_ALLOCATION_LIMIT_BYTES = 3,
63#define M_SET_ALLOCATION_LIMIT_BYTES M_SET_ALLOCATION_LIMIT_BYTES
Christopher Ferris8189e772019-04-09 16:37:23 -070064 // Called after the zygote forks to indicate this is a child.
65 M_SET_ZYGOTE_CHILD = 4,
66#define M_SET_ZYGOTE_CHILD M_SET_ZYGOTE_CHILD
Christopher Ferris30659fd2019-04-15 19:01:08 -070067
68 // Options to dump backtraces of allocations. These options only
69 // work when malloc debug has been enabled.
70
71 // Writes the backtrace information of all current allocations to a file.
72 // NOTE: arg_size has to be sizeof(FILE*) because FILE is an opaque type.
73 // arg = FILE*
74 // arg_size = sizeof(FILE*)
75 M_WRITE_MALLOC_LEAK_INFO_TO_FILE = 5,
76#define M_WRITE_MALLOC_LEAK_INFO_TO_FILE M_WRITE_MALLOC_LEAK_INFO_TO_FILE
77 // Get information about the backtraces of all
78 // arg = android_mallopt_leak_info_t*
79 // arg_size = sizeof(android_mallopt_leak_info_t)
80 M_GET_MALLOC_LEAK_INFO = 6,
81#define M_GET_MALLOC_LEAK_INFO M_GET_MALLOC_LEAK_INFO
82 // Free the memory allocated and returned by M_GET_MALLOC_LEAK_INFO.
83 // arg = android_mallopt_leak_info_t*
84 // arg_size = sizeof(android_mallopt_leak_info_t)
85 M_FREE_MALLOC_LEAK_INFO = 7,
86#define M_FREE_MALLOC_LEAK_INFO M_FREE_MALLOC_LEAK_INFO
Ryan Savitskif77928d2019-01-23 18:39:35 +000087};
Ryan Savitskiecc37e32018-12-14 15:57:21 +000088
89// Manipulates bionic-specific handling of memory allocation APIs such as
90// malloc. Only for use by the Android platform itself.
91//
92// On success, returns true. On failure, returns false and sets errno.
93extern "C" bool android_mallopt(int opcode, void* arg, size_t arg_size);
